52Mbps Precision Delay RS485 Fail-Safe Transceivers

Part Details

  • Precision Propagation Delay Over Temperature: Receiver/Driver: 18.5ns ±3.5ns
  • High Data Rate: 52Mbps
  • Low tPLH/tPHL Skew: Receiver/Driver: 500ps Typ
  • –7V to 12V RS485 Input Common Mode Range
  • Guaranteed Fail-Safe Operation Over the Entire Common Mode Range
  • High Input Resistance: ≥22k, Even When Unpowered
  • Short-Circuit Protected
  • Thermal Shutdown Protected
  • Driver Maintains High Impedance in Three-State or with Power Off
  • Single 5V Supply
  • Pin Compatible with LTC490/LTC491
  • 45dB CMRR at 26MHz

Standard RS-485 Full-Duplex (8-lead SOIC) Evaluation Board, EVAL-RS485FD8EBZ

Product Details

The EVAL-RS485FD8EBZ allows quick and easy evaluation of full-duplex RS-485 transceivers with standard 8-lead SOIC footprints. The evaluation board allows interfacing via screw terminal block to digital I/O for driver input (DI) and receiver output (RO). Bus signals A, B, Y and Z (full-duplex bus) can be connected to a bus screw terminal block. Termination resistors are fitted across A and B, as well as Y and Z. These can be connected in half-duplex configuration (A to Y, B to Z), in order to evaluate the RS-485 driver. Footprints are provided for pull-up and pull-down (biasing resistors) on the receiver inputs in order to provide the option to evaluate an RS-485 receiver with this configuration.

Devices for evaluation on the board must be ordered separately.
